Cardano is a a Proof-of-Stake blockchain network that poised to be the biggest competitor to Ethereum network. Like Ethereum, Cardano supports robust smart contract. Unlike Ethereum (the 1.0 version), it is more energy-efficient with a low network transaction fee.
Cardano is founded by Charles Hoskinson, who happens to be the co-founder of Ethereum. It is built based on a set of philosophical ideas, developed by academic experts and constantly being peer-reviewed. Some key issues Cardano sets to solve includes blockchain scalability, interoperability and sustainability.
ADA is the native token on Cardano, which can be used for transactions and staking. At the time of writing, Cardano's Ada is the fifth-largest cryptocurrency by market cap and the second-largest PoS blockchain by the same measure (data from coingecko).
If you prefer to use a Ledger Hardware Wallet, you could use AdaLite or Yoroi wallet interface to manage your ADAs, including staking. Please check out the Ledger guide for the details.
If you prefer a desktop wallet, there are several choices on the market, please do your own research. Both Yoroi and AdaLite can be used as a stand-alone software wallet. Daedalus desktop wallet is another popular choice among ADA holders.
Staking ADA could help you gain rewards while securing the network as a whole. If a stake pool operators is selected to mint the next block, the pool will receive a reward and the rewards are shared proportionately with each member that has delegated to this pool. The more delegation a pool receives, the bigger chance it has to be selected as the next slot leader.
